diff options
author | Jessica Wagantall <jwagantall@linuxfoundation.org> | 2018-07-18 10:12:11 -0700 |
---|---|---|
committer | Jessica Wagantall <jwagantall@linuxfoundation.org> | 2018-07-18 12:13:55 -0700 |
commit | 8254e35e45de7860bf71f39a3490657ea52f34e7 (patch) | |
tree | 24abcdc4c10ef584e1a026b8cfe3ef27c2ea500f /jjb | |
parent | bd1eb46f90da44b7b6a29312114fe76fcc11db58 (diff) |
Add INFO.yaml verify job
- Add verification for INFO.yaml files in VNFSDK
- Fix line separation between projects in yaml files
- Fix clm jobs that do not need parameters
Change-Id: I26a3ece73a8b70a35816609f059b1c38a6037132
Issue-ID: CIMAN-134
Signed-off-by: Jessica Wagantall <jwagantall@linuxfoundation.org>
Diffstat (limited to 'jjb')
-rw-r--r-- | jjb/vnfsdk/vnfsdk-dovetail-integration-python.yaml | 9 | ||||
-rw-r--r-- | jjb/vnfsdk/vnfsdk-functest.yaml | 11 | ||||
-rw-r--r-- | jjb/vnfsdk/vnfsdk-ice-python.yaml | 10 | ||||
-rw-r--r-- | jjb/vnfsdk/vnfsdk-lctest.yaml | 9 | ||||
-rw-r--r-- | jjb/vnfsdk/vnfsdk-pkgtools-python.yaml | 9 | ||||
-rw-r--r-- | jjb/vnfsdk/vnfsdk-refrepo.yaml | 12 | ||||
-rw-r--r-- | jjb/vnfsdk/vnfsdk-validation.yaml | 14 | ||||
-rw-r--r-- | jjb/vnfsdk/vnfsdk-ves-agent.yaml | 10 |
8 files changed, 76 insertions, 8 deletions
diff --git a/jjb/vnfsdk/vnfsdk-dovetail-integration-python.yaml b/jjb/vnfsdk/vnfsdk-dovetail-integration-python.yaml index 9a736da1a..3a704face 100644 --- a/jjb/vnfsdk/vnfsdk-dovetail-integration-python.yaml +++ b/jjb/vnfsdk/vnfsdk-dovetail-integration-python.yaml @@ -26,6 +26,7 @@ docker-pom: 'pom.xml' mvn-profile: 'docker' mvn-params: '-Dmaven.test.skip=true' + - project: name: vnfsdk-dovetail-integration-tox-sonar jobs: @@ -38,3 +39,11 @@ mvn-settings: 'vnfsdk-dovetail-integration-settings' mvn-goals: 'clean install' mvn-opts: '-Xmx1024m -XX:MaxPermSize=256m' + +- project: + name: vnfsdk-dovetail-integration-info + jobs: + - gerrit-info-yaml-verify + project: 'vnfsdk/dovetail-integration' + project-name: 'vnfsdk-dovetail-integration' + branch: 'master' diff --git a/jjb/vnfsdk/vnfsdk-functest.yaml b/jjb/vnfsdk/vnfsdk-functest.yaml index ec97de332..85e9b1bd8 100644 --- a/jjb/vnfsdk/vnfsdk-functest.yaml +++ b/jjb/vnfsdk/vnfsdk-functest.yaml @@ -3,7 +3,7 @@ name: vnfsdk-functest project-name: 'vnfsdk-functest' jobs: - - gerrit-maven-clm: + - gerrit-maven-clm - '{project-name}-{stream}-verify-java' - '{project-name}-{stream}-merge-java' - '{project-name}-{stream}-release-version-java-daily' @@ -16,6 +16,7 @@ files: '**' archive-artifacts: '' build-node: ubuntu1604-builder-4c-4g + - project: name: vnfsdk-functest-sonar jobs: @@ -28,3 +29,11 @@ mvn-settings: 'vnfsdk-functest-settings' mvn-goals: 'clean install' mvn-opts: '-Xmx1024m -XX:MaxPermSize=256m' + +- project: + name: vnfsdk-functest-info + jobs: + - gerrit-info-yaml-verify + project: 'vnfsdk/functest' + project-name: 'vnfsdk-functest' + branch: 'master' diff --git a/jjb/vnfsdk/vnfsdk-ice-python.yaml b/jjb/vnfsdk/vnfsdk-ice-python.yaml index a3ad7d348..223eeefaf 100644 --- a/jjb/vnfsdk/vnfsdk-ice-python.yaml +++ b/jjb/vnfsdk/vnfsdk-ice-python.yaml @@ -29,6 +29,7 @@ - '{project-name}-{stream}-{subproject}-merge-java' - '{project-name}-{subproject}-python-staging-{stream}' - '{project-name}-{subproject}-python-release-{stream}' + - project: name: vnfsdk-ice-docker project-name: 'vnfsdk-ice-docker' @@ -50,6 +51,7 @@ docker-pom: 'docker/pom.xml' mvn-profile: 'docker' mvn-params: '-Dmaven.test.skip=true' + - project: name: vnfsdk-ice-validation-scripts-tox-sonar jobs: @@ -63,6 +65,7 @@ mvn-settings: 'vnfsdk-ice-settings' mvn-goals: 'clean install' mvn-opts: '-Xmx1024m -XX:MaxPermSize=256m' + - project: name: vnfsdk-ice-ice-server-tox-sonar jobs: @@ -77,3 +80,10 @@ mvn-goals: 'clean install' mvn-opts: '-Xmx1024m -XX:MaxPermSize=256m' +- project: + name: vnfsdk-ice-info + jobs: + - gerrit-info-yaml-verify + project: 'vnfsdk/ice' + project-name: 'vnfsdk-ice' + branch: 'master' diff --git a/jjb/vnfsdk/vnfsdk-lctest.yaml b/jjb/vnfsdk/vnfsdk-lctest.yaml index 9a7e2a19d..e77fa78fb 100644 --- a/jjb/vnfsdk/vnfsdk-lctest.yaml +++ b/jjb/vnfsdk/vnfsdk-lctest.yaml @@ -5,9 +5,16 @@ jobs: - '{project-name}-{stream}-verify-java' - '{project-name}-{stream}-merge-java' - project-name: 'vnfsdk-lctest' stream: - 'master': branch: 'master' mvn-settings: 'vnfsdk-lctest-settings' + +- project: + name: vnfsdk-lctest-info + jobs: + - gerrit-info-yaml-verify + project: 'vnfsdk/lctest' + project-name: 'vnfsdk-lctest' + branch: 'master' diff --git a/jjb/vnfsdk/vnfsdk-pkgtools-python.yaml b/jjb/vnfsdk/vnfsdk-pkgtools-python.yaml index a0480d120..2ed1153c7 100644 --- a/jjb/vnfsdk/vnfsdk-pkgtools-python.yaml +++ b/jjb/vnfsdk/vnfsdk-pkgtools-python.yaml @@ -20,6 +20,7 @@ - '{project-name}-{stream}-{subproject}-verify-python' - '{project-name}-{subproject}-python-staging-{stream}' - '{project-name}-{subproject}-python-release-{stream}' + - project: name: vnfsdk-pkgtools-tox-sonar jobs: @@ -32,3 +33,11 @@ mvn-settings: 'vnfsdk-pkgtools-settings' mvn-goals: 'clean install' mvn-opts: '-Xmx1024m -XX:MaxPermSize=256m' + +- project: + name: vnfsdk-pkgtools-info + jobs: + - gerrit-info-yaml-verify + project: 'vnfsdk/pkgtools' + project-name: 'vnfsdk-pkgtools' + branch: 'master' diff --git a/jjb/vnfsdk/vnfsdk-refrepo.yaml b/jjb/vnfsdk/vnfsdk-refrepo.yaml index 0b07b1071..debb979a7 100644 --- a/jjb/vnfsdk/vnfsdk-refrepo.yaml +++ b/jjb/vnfsdk/vnfsdk-refrepo.yaml @@ -3,7 +3,7 @@ name: vnfsdk-refrepo project-name: 'vnfsdk-refrepo' jobs: - - gerrit-maven-clm: + - gerrit-maven-clm - '{project-name}-{stream}-verify-java' - '{project-name}-{stream}-merge-java' - '{project-name}-{stream}-release-version-java-daily' @@ -15,7 +15,6 @@ docker-pom: 'vnfmarket-be/deployment/docker/docker-postgres/pom.xml' mvn-profile: 'docker' mvn-params: '-Dmaven.test.skip=true' - project: 'vnfsdk/refrepo' stream: - 'master': @@ -24,6 +23,7 @@ files: '**' archive-artifacts: '' build-node: ubuntu1604-builder-4c-4g + - project: name: vnfsdk-refrepo-sonar jobs: @@ -36,3 +36,11 @@ mvn-settings: 'vnfsdk-refrepo-settings' mvn-goals: 'clean install' mvn-opts: '-Xmx1024m -XX:MaxPermSize=256m' + +- project: + name: vnfsdk-refrepo-info + jobs: + - gerrit-info-yaml-verify + project: 'vnfsdk/refrepo' + project-name: 'vnfsdk-refrepo' + branch: 'master' diff --git a/jjb/vnfsdk/vnfsdk-validation.yaml b/jjb/vnfsdk/vnfsdk-validation.yaml index 79b857359..7e85987ce 100644 --- a/jjb/vnfsdk/vnfsdk-validation.yaml +++ b/jjb/vnfsdk/vnfsdk-validation.yaml @@ -3,11 +3,10 @@ name: vnfsdk-validation project-name: 'vnfsdk-validation' jobs: - - gerrit-maven-clm: + - gerrit-maven-clm - '{project-name}-{stream}-verify-java' - '{project-name}-{stream}-merge-java' - '{project-name}-{stream}-release-version-java-daily' - project: 'vnfsdk/validation' stream: - 'master': @@ -16,6 +15,7 @@ files: '**' archive-artifacts: '' build-node: ubuntu1604-builder-4c-4g + - project: name: vnfsdk-validation-sonar jobs: @@ -27,4 +27,12 @@ branch: 'master' mvn-settings: 'vnfsdk-validation-settings' mvn-goals: 'clean install' - mvn-opts: '-Xmx1024m -XX:MaxPermSize=256m'
\ No newline at end of file + mvn-opts: '-Xmx1024m -XX:MaxPermSize=256m' + +- project: + name: vnfsdk-validation-info + jobs: + - gerrit-info-yaml-verify + project: 'vnfsdk/validation' + project-name: 'vnfsdk-validation' + branch: 'master' diff --git a/jjb/vnfsdk/vnfsdk-ves-agent.yaml b/jjb/vnfsdk/vnfsdk-ves-agent.yaml index ac77b7701..37d5b9c1c 100644 --- a/jjb/vnfsdk/vnfsdk-ves-agent.yaml +++ b/jjb/vnfsdk/vnfsdk-ves-agent.yaml @@ -14,7 +14,6 @@ - '{project-name}-{stream}-{subproject}-verify-java' - '{project-name}-{stream}-{subproject}-merge-java' - '{project-name}-{stream}-{subproject}-release-java-daily' - project: 'vnfsdk/ves-agent' stream: - 'master': @@ -23,6 +22,7 @@ files: '**' archive-artifacts: '' build-node: ubuntu1604-builder-4c-4g + - project: name: vnfsdk-ves-agent-sonar jobs: @@ -36,3 +36,11 @@ mvn-settings: 'vnfsdk-ves-agent-settings' mvn-goals: 'clean install' mvn-opts: '-Xmx1024m -XX:MaxPermSize=256m' + +- project: + name: vnfsdk-ves-agent-info + jobs: + - gerrit-info-yaml-verify + project: 'vnfsdk/ves-agent' + project-name: 'vnfsdk-ves-agent' + branch: 'master' |